Taxonomy Code 405300000X
Display Name Prevention Professional
Taxonomy Group Other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Prevention Professional
Definition Prevention Professionals work in programs aimed to address specific patient needs, such as suicide prevention, violence prevention, alcohol avoidance, drug avoidance, and tobacco prevention. The goal of the program is to reduce the risk of relapse, injury, or re-injury of the patient. Prevention Professionals work in a variety of settings and provide appropriate case management, mediation, referral, and mentorship services. Individuals complete prevention professionals training for the population of patients with whom they work.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
